About Nora Kory

Nora Kory is a scholar working on Molecular Biology, Biochemistry, Epidemiology, Cancer Research and Clinical Biochemistry, having authored 22 papers that have together received 2.7k indexed citations. Recurring topics across this work include Lipid metabolism and biosynthesis (8 papers), Mitochondrial Function and Pathology (7 papers), Photosynthetic Processes and Mechanisms (4 papers), Metabolism and Genetic Disorders (3 papers), Cancer, Hypoxia, and Metabolism (3 papers), Liver Disease Diagnosis and Treatment (2 papers), Metabolomics and Mass Spectrometry Studies (2 papers) and Microbial Metabolic Engineering and Bioproduction (2 papers). The work is most often cited by research in Biochemistry (847 citations), Aging (75 citations), Endocrine and Autonomic Systems (223 citations), Cell Biology (389 citations) and Physiology (531 citations). Nora Kory has collaborated with scholars based in United States, Germany and Canada. Frequent co-authors include Tobias C. Walther, Robert V. Farese, Natalie Krahmer, Liron Bar‐Peled, David M. Sabatini, Heather R. Keys, Caroline A. Lewis, Jonathan C. Cohen, Susan Lindquist and Helen H. Hobbs. Their work appears in journals such as Developmental Cell, Journal of Lipid Research, Proceedings of the National Academy of Sciences, Cell Metabolism and Nature Metabolism.
